Can anyone help me?
I've recently updated my computer and software and don't seem to have access
to as many fonts as before in Microsoft Word. Can I import them from
anywhere? It's really annoying as my company logo and correspondence is in a
particular font and I don't really want to start again.....
Thanks in anticipation...

There are thousands of sites you can purchase fonts from and many
sites you can get free fonts but if you had them before in Word, then
perhaps you still have them on the Word or Office installation media?
The latest version of Word may not have as many fonts as some previous
versions. For detailed information, try the Office group and mention
your version of Word or Office.
news://msnews.microsoft.com/microsoft.public.office.misc

Mention the particular font when you repost and someone may be able to
help.
